Ahmed Ibrahim Mohamed Khair, secretary-general of the workers union in South Darfur told Radio Dabanga from Nyala city that the strike is 100 percent successful in all the localities. He stressed that the work stoppage will continue until a comprehensive solution is reached. The Democratic Teachers Alliance in South Darfur issued a statement on Wednesday announcing its full support for the strike. It called the democratic teachers to unite so as to regain the Union of Education Workers from the National Congress Party affiliates. Shamsel Din Mohamed Saleh, Chairman of the preparatory committee of the Democratic Teachers Alliance told Radio Dabanga from Nyala that the announcement of the strike came very late, only after pressure from the localities\u2019 branch unions. He pointed out that the financial entitlements of the ministry\u2019s staff have accumulated for years. He added that the current Union did not claim the rights of the workers because it prioritises political action over professional demands. The teachers protest against the non-payment of their financial entitlements accumulated since 2007, amounting to SDG75,000 ($13,100) a person, a member of the South Darfur State\u2019s Employees Union told Radio Dabanga. The entitlements include benefits and promotion raises.
